What Is an Emergency Electrician and What Qualifies as an Electrical Emergency?

An emergency electrician is a licensed professional available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, including holidays, to handle urgent electrical problems that pose an immediate safety risk or could cause significant property damage. They are equipped and ready to respond when your regular electrician's office is closed.

So, what is an electrical emergency? It's any situation where delaying repair is dangerous. Common examples include:

  • Power Outages Isolated to Your Home: If your neighbors have power but you don't, the issue is likely on your property.
  • Burning Smell, Sparks, or Smoke from Outlets, Switches, or Panels: This indicates overheating and is a major fire hazard.
  • Exposed or Arcing Wires: Wires that are damaged, chewed by pests, or sparking.
  • Water Contact with Electrical Systems: After a leak, flood, or major appliance overflow.
  • Frequent Circuit Breaker Tripping: This can signal an overloaded or faulty circuit.
  • Damaged or Fallen Power Lines on Your Property: This is extremely dangerous and requires both the utility company and an electrician.

Local Challenges: Farragut's Climate, Homes, and Electrical Systems

Our local environment directly impacts your home's electrical health. Farragut experiences hot, humid summers with frequent and powerful afternoon thunderstorms. These storms can cause power surges, down trees onto service lines, and lead to flooding in lower-lying areas. In older neighborhoods, like those near the historic Campbell Station area, homes built before the 1980s may still have aluminum branch wiring or undersized 60- or 100-amp service panels that struggle with modern appliance loads, making them more prone to overheating.

Furthermore, the humidity can accelerate corrosion on outdoor connections and in panels located in damp basements or crawl spaces. Understanding the Cost of an Emergency Electrician in Farragut

One of the most common questions we hear is, "How much is an emergency electrician call-out?" It's important to be transparent. Emergency services cost more than scheduled appointments due to after-hours staffing, priority dispatch, and the urgent nature of the work.

The total cost typically includes several components:

  1. Emergency Call-Out / Dispatch Fee: This is a flat fee to mobilize the truck and technician, usually ranging from $99 to $199 in the Farragut area.
  2. After-Hours Premium: Labor rates for nights, weekends, and holidays are often 1.5 to 2.5 times the standard hourly rate. Standard rates in Knox County are roughly $75-$125/hour, so emergency labor can be $115-$200+/hour.
  3. Diagnostics: Time spent identifying the problem.
  4. Parts & Materials: Any breakers, wiring, conduits, etc., needed for the repair.
  5. Permit/Inspection Fees: For major work like a panel replacement, a permit from the City of Farragut or Knox County may be required, adding to the cost.

Example Scenario: A homeowner in the Village Green area has a burning outlet on a Saturday night. The emergency call-out fee is $149. The electrician diagnoses a faulty connection and replaces the outlet (1 hour of emergency labor at $175 + $25 for the high-grade outlet). The total cost would be in the ballpark of $350. While an investment, it prevents a potential house fire.

What to Do Until Your Emergency Electrician Arrives: A Safety Checklist

  1. Ensure Safety: If it's safe to do so, go to your main breaker panel and turn off the power to the affected circuit or the whole house. If you smell gas alongside electrical issues, evacuate and call 911.
  2. Evacuate the Area: Keep everyone, especially children and pets, away from the problem area.
  3. Call the Utility if Needed: For downed power lines or if you lose power but your neighbors don't, contact KUB at (865) 524-2911.
  4. Document the Issue: Take clear photos of any damage, sparks, or affected equipment for insurance purposes.
  5. Prepare for the Electrician: Clear a path to your electrical panel and the problem area. Have your home's electrical history ready if possible.

Local Regulations and Safety Final Notes

In Farragut, any major electrical work like a service upgrade or new circuit installation requires a permit and subsequent inspection from the local building department. A reputable emergency electrician will handle this process for you. Always ensure your electrician is licensed by the State of Tennessee. Remember, for any work on the lines leading up to your meter, KUB must be involved to disconnect and reconnect service.
